About the Youngstown market
What is the median home price in Youngstown, NY?
The median sale price in Youngstown, NY is $377,333 (data through August 2026), based on deeds recorded with the county. That is up 38.2% from a year earlier.
How many homes sell in Youngstown, NY each year?
69 homes sold in Youngstown, NY over the last 12 months (data through August 2026). TopHap counts recorded arm's-length deeds, not listings, so the figure is not affected by which brokerage handled the sale.
Is Youngstown, NY a buyer's or seller's market?
Youngstown, NY is currently a balanced market, scoring 47 out of 100 on TopHap's market temperature index (data through August 2026). The score weighs sales velocity and price direction; above 60 favours sellers, below 40 favours buyers.
How many homes are there in Youngstown, NY?
Youngstown, NY contains 2,288 residential properties, with a median of 1,740 square feet, 3 bedrooms, built around 1966. The median TopHap Estimate is $316K.
How does Youngstown, NY compare to the rest of Niagara County?
By median home value, Youngstown, NY is the 2nd most expensive of 8 cities in Niagara County. Its typical home is worth more than 74% of all homes in Niagara County. Lewiston ranks just above it and North Tonawanda just below. The ranking is rebuilt nightly from the county assessor record of every home in each area.
Do people own or rent in Youngstown, NY?
83% of homes in Youngstown, NY are owner-occupied. 12% are held by a company rather than an individual.
How much equity do owners in Youngstown, NY hold?
60% of mortgaged homes in Youngstown, NY are equity-rich, meaning the loan balance is under half the home's value. 1.1% owe more than the home is worth.
